Senior Devsecops Engineer

 

Description:

The successful candidates will be responsible for designing, developing and maintaining mission-critical DevSecOps applications and managing systems that allow for the efficient integration and delivery of software services. They will lead the technical scoping, design and delivery of a product deliverable/workstream, and will act as lead technical teams of 3-5 associates.

 

Primary duties may include but are not limited to:

  • Design and implement of all aspects of DevSecOps automation capabilities for applications and ML applications.
  • Build DevSecOps automations on cloud (AWS, Azure, or GCP):
  • Data science model review, run the code refactoring and optimization, containerization, deployment, versioning, and monitoring of its quality.
  • Data science models testing, validation and tests automation.
  • Communicate with a team of data scientists, data engineers and architect, document the processes.
  • Build CI/CD pipelines orchestration by OpenShift, Tekton, GitLab, GitHub Actions, Circle CI, Airflow or similar tools.
  • Automate all aspects of software delivery lifecycle.
  • Drive implementation and maintenance of cloud native solutions and practices.
  • Develop and strengthen technical skills of team members through coaching and mentoring.
  • Work with business stakeholders to ensure alignment of DevSecOps objectives with overall business objectives.
  • Collaborate with other technology teams such as development, infrastructure, and QA to ensure smooth deployment and delivery of releases.
  • Ensure stable and scalable operation of systems through proactive monitoring, analysis, and problem-solving.
  • Ensure best practices are followed in areas such as security, infrastructure, and code quality.
  • Foster a culture of automation, continuous improvement, and experimentation.

 

Leadership:

  • Provide mentorship to junior associates.
  • Identify skills gaps within the team and coordinate training or learning opportunities to address.
  • Navigate complex or ambiguous problems and guide the team towards effective solutions.
  • Facilitate discussions to resolve technical disagreements, guiding the team towards alignment whilst considering diverse viewpoints.
  • Identify potential risks, dependencies and challenges early, working with the team to mitigate them and develop contingency plans.
  • Identify performing outliers and proactively highlight to management to ensure appropriate development plan.
  • Active contribution to team building initiatives to support team growth and create process efficiencies.

 

 

Communication:

  • Communicate with all levels in the company and adjust content to the audience as necessary.
  • Engage with the agile team and cross-functional stakeholders to interpret and understand project requirements and business context for potential data solutions.
  • Provide impactful insights based on analysis/build outcomes and make recommendations to leadership and influence the team to increase business impact.
  • Provide clear executive communication to senior leadership as required to ensure awareness of key product updates and provide a channel of communication between senior leadership and the project team.
  • Communicate with cross-functional stakeholders to understand data content and business requirements.
  • Articulate clearly the business requirements, project scope and individual responsibilities to the workstream.
  • Present technical findings internally.
  • Seek and provide regular feedback amongst colleagues and actively share feedback on technical team with the respective managers.

 

Requirements:

  • Bachelor’s degree and 5+ years of relevant experience in a DevSecOps or Cloud Engineering role or related field.
  • Experience with DevSecOps Frameworks (Gitlab/Github/Tekton/etc),
  • Experience with Ansible, ArgoCD and ArgoWorkFlow.
  • Experience with Docker and Kubernetes/OpenShift.
  • Skillset:
  • YAML pipeline design and implementation on GitHub/Gitlab/Tekton or similar.
  • Hands on programming – Python/Go/Ruby.
  • Serverless stack AWS, AWS SageMaker, GCP.
  • Containerisation.
  • Experience with AWS/GCP/Azure.
  • CloudFormation/Terraform.

Organization Carelon Global Solutions Ireland
Industry IT / Telecom / Software
Occupational Category Senior DevSecOps Engineer
Job Location Limerick,Ireland
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 5 Years
Posted at 2024-05-07 1:03 pm
Expires on 2024-10-08